Present Your Child An Opportunity To Judge
Children fight for their right to be self-determined. I have a 5-year old daughter. When I want to advice her on something I go down on my knees so that I'm not towering over her. I touch her arm so she realises that I'm there for her, & we set up good contact. I give her a broad smile & I tell her: "Hi," & she responds: "Hi," and I say: "Press my nose," & she presses my nose gently and we laugh, & iI press her nose, & we understand our great bonding, & I tell her: "Honey, I've got to talk to you, can I?" And I've prepared her to ready to hear me out. In raising kids this is necessary.
And then, once - truly, just one time not a 1000 I tell: "Have you noticed? Those socks are dirty." "Yeah." "Do you know where they go?" She replies: "No." I say: "They are cleaned in the laundry You know where that is?" "Oh, yea." "You want to do it as a race?" I provide her with options. She requires them because it is very different from being ordered about. "OK, would you like to bring the left sock or the right sock?" She gives it a thought. "I pick the left one." "Which one is it?" "That one." "Right. Do you want to run forward or backward." She thinks and says: "Yea." "All right." She does not take it lightly. There are absolutely no children's behaviour problems here.

Make Your Child As A Grown Up
Hence on the next occasion you get angry as you are doing your child's work, and you really hate it, make up your mind that you will invest some time & teach your child one thing at a time. This will help him realise his duties you'll never have to do for him again. And make it enjoyable.
If you spend some hours teaching him in a simple manner, this is something you'll never have to do again. You don't have to teach your kid many things : it's always the same things: the dishes, the shoes, the laundry, the skateboard on the stairs, the shating shoes the roller skates in the hall way.
If you attempt to understand children's psychology and teach your child good humouredly, relaxedly, playfully and patiently, in exactly the similar fashion that you treat your older friends/ acquaintances, he or she will definitely respond really well & you will be spared of the aggressive behavior problem with children that is mostly associated with kids.
